Correction: Virus Outbreak-The Latest story

Nevada Gov. Steve Sisolak exits a press conference at the Nevada State Legislature in Carson City, Nev. on Wednesday, June 24, 2020. Sisolak announced Nevada would join California, Washington and North Carolina in requiring individuals wear masks in public places to contain the spread of coronavirus.(AP Photo/Samuel Metz)
Original Publication Date June 23, 2020 - 10:01 PM

In a story June 24, 2020, about the virus outbreak, The Associated Press erroneously reported twice that New York, New Jersey and Connecticut would need travellers entering these states to go into quarantine for 24 days because of COVID-19 concerns. The quarantine will be for 14 days.
